About this House

Waterfront home in beautiful Madeira Beach...3 walking blocks to Gulf of Mexico beach access. Enjoy Boca Ciega Bay from the dock or lounge in the custom pool and hot tub. All new EVERYTHING. Evening sunsets never disappoint!


266 145th Ave E, Madeira Beach, FL 33708 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,433 sqft single-family home built in 1953. It last sold for $1,250,000 on Sep 15, 2022.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$1,008,200, with a rent estimate of $5,608/month.

    "I am an airline pilot and I need access to major airports in order to commute to work. Both St Pete (PIE) and Tampa International (TPA) are 25 to 30 minute drives away from my beach house. My wife worked in downtown St. Pete for a while and her drive was 20-25 minutes with commuter traffic. Car insurance premiums are a little higher in Florida than other places I have lived. "
